Learn blockchain fundamentals and build an energy trading marketplace—smart contracts, tokenized energy assets, Web2↔Web3 integration, security, and cross-chain deployment.
Blockchain for Energy Sector is a live, instructor-led program focused on practical energy use-cases: asset representation, smart contracts, and marketplace workflows. You’ll learn Solidity foundations, token design for energy assets, local development and gas concepts, Web2↔Web3 integration for dApps, security and protocol comparisons, and a marketplace build (smart contract + frontend). The program ends with cross-chain deployment concepts, case studies, and a capstone demo.
